Hasselblad's X2D II 100C offers improved autofocus and world-beating stabilization

Hasselblad has launched the X2D II 100C, an updated version of its 100MP medium-format camera. The new model offers several improvements, including better autofocus with phase-detect AF and AI algorithms, a brighter display, and up to 10 stops of image stabilization - the highest of any camera. The camera also features a 16-bit RAW sensor with 15.3 stops of dynamic range, as well as support for true end-to-end HDR. The X2D II 100C is priced at $7,399, which is $800 less than the previous model. Hasselblad has also introduced a new zoom lens, the XCD 2.8-4 35-100E, as well as a Hasselblad-branded Vandra 20-liter backpack and several filters.
